Greyfield Wood is in High Littleton, Bristol and in Bath And North East Somerset district. BS39 6YE is located in the Clutton & Farmborough elect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of North East Somerset. This postcode has been in use since 1997-12-01.

Partnership Status

Across the UK, the average relationship status breakdown is roughly 44% married, 38% single, 9% divorced, 6% widowed, and 2% separated.

In the immediate vicinity of BS39 6YE there is a very large concentration of residents that are married - 52.2% of the resident population. In contrast, the average marriage rate across the census is about 44%.

Areas with a high percentage of married residents are typically suburban neighborhoods, towns with good schools and family-friendly amenities, and regions with affordable, spacious housing options. Additionally, such areas can be popular among retirees.

Health

Across the UK, the average 48.4% rated their health as Very Good, 33.6% as Good, 12.7% as Fair, 4% as Bad, and 1.2% as Very Bad.

Population age significantly impacts residents' health. Additionally, socioeconomic status plays a crucial role: higher income levels and lower poverty rates are linked to better health outcomes. Affluent areas benefit from higher living standards, access to private healthcare, and healthier lifestyle choices.

This area has a high percentage of residents reporting their health as Good or Very Good (88.2%) compared to the average (82%). This typically indicates either a younger population or more affluent area.

Safety

Is Greyfield Wood Street dangerous?

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Greyfield Wood was 76.4 per 1,000 residents, which is 117.7% higher than the Chew Valley average. The most reported crime type was Violence and sexual offences.

Greyfield Wood has the 8th highest crime rate of 43 local areas in Chew Valley and the 191st highest crime rate of 598 local areas in Bath and North East Somerset .

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 46.8 crimes per 1,000 residents and have been rising year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has risen by about 143.5%.

Employment

BS39 6YE area has a very high level of entrepreneurship. Only 12% of streets have higher percent of entrepreneur residents. 14% of population in this area is self-employed, while the average in the UK is 9.7%. High number of entrepreneurs usually leads to relatively high economic growth, higher paid jobs and better quality of life in the area.

BS39 6YE area has a low unemployment rate. According to Census 2021, 3% residents of this area were unemployed, while the average in the UK was 4.83%. A low level of unemployment in an area indicates a strong job market, where most people who are seeking work can find employment. This generally reflects a healthy economy in the area.
